Babbie Rural and Farm Learning Museum

Getting hands-on with history

A lifelong dream of retired rural farmer, Leeward Babbie, the Babbie Museum provides visitors with an opportunity for hands-on experiences with farm tools used more than 100 years ago. A full-sized stagecoach, old farm furnishings, and a restored shingle mill visitors will make you feel like you are in the year 1850. A petting zoo with hens, horses, and miniature donkeys will make the kids yearning to bring one home.
